Hardwood Flooring AustinIt will always be recommended to repair a subfloor before establishing the hardwood floor. The subfloor ought to be leveled and made of a good material. This subfloor secures gives a better platform for establishing the hardwood flooring than concrete slabs. Subfloors also lock moisture that may damage your beautiful wooden floors. In areas which may have a lot of moisture, like bathrooms, it is advisable to avoid solid hardwood flooring and set up laminate wood flooring instead. This laminate floor is not a real wood floor but appears like it.Austin Hardwood FlooringHardwood flooring can be set up by gluing or nailing it towards the floor plank by plank. There are different types you can purchase. Some don't require subfloors and can often be fixed towards the floor. Some floors are very engineered ones that will stand up to some moisture. Some are floating wood flooring comprising planks added with tongue-and-groove joint style. Some have an overabundance complex installation processes.
